M700 Compact Single Mode OTDR

The Noyes M700 from AFL Telecommunications is a compact, full featured, single-mode OTDR that includes an integrated Visual Fault Locator (VFL), an Optical Power Meter (OPM) displaying up to three wavelengths simultaneously, and a large transflective touch screen display suitable for both indoor and outdoor operation.


The M700 OTDR supports Real Time, Full-Auto, and Expert (manual) modes, precision event analysis, dual-wavelength testing, rich file naming, and an intuitive job set-up functionality. In addition to OTDR event analysis, pass/fail acceptance values, and marginal warning, specific values can be set to alert the test operator of failing or marginal events. Using one of the Least Squares Approximation (LSA) loss methods, events may be added or deleted manually.
Thousands of OTDR and OPM test results can be stored internally or on the supplied USB drive, and are transferable via a USB cable or drive to a computer for viewing, printing and analyzing with supplied Windows® compatible software. Saved OPM loss values for a cable in one or two directions can be displayed in a table on the M700 for evaluation and comparison.

With short dead zones, a dynamic range of 38 dB, and greater than 8-hour battery life during continuous testing, the M700 is perfect for testing optical fibres in service provider metro areas.

  • 38 / 36 dB dynamic range @ 1310 / 1550 nm
  • Integrated Optical Power Meter (OPM) and Visual Fault Locator (VFL, 650 nm)
  • LSA Measurements and manual events in Expert mode
  • Pass/Fail Event and Link Thresholds settings
  • OTDR results saved as industry standard (GR-196) .SOR files
  • OPM stores results and displays up to three wavelengths simultaneously
  • Large, high bright, sunlight readable, transflective touch screen
  • Tool-free, switchable adapters (SC/FC/LC)
  • Integrated fibre launch ring holder
  • 2 USB host ports
  • USB drive and Windows® compatible software included
 

OFL250 handheld OTDR

The Noyes OFL 250 from AFL Telecommunications is a single-mode OTDR with an integrated Optical Power Meter (OPM), Laser Source (OLS), and Visual Fault Locator (VFL) in a handheld package weighing only 0.8 kg (1.7 lb). With short dead zone and mid-range dynamic range performance, the OFL 250 is ideal for testing optical fibres in service provider metro areas and FTTx networks.

The OFL 250 provides automatic and manual setup, precision event analysis, multiple-wavelength testing, a 12-hour battery life, internal data storage, and USB connectivity. OTDR and OPM test ports are equipped with tool-free adapters, which can be changed in seconds.

Results are saved as industry standard .SOR files, which can be transferred to a PC for viewing, printing, and analyzing with the supplied Windows® compatible software.


 

Features:
  • Handheld, 0.8 kg (1.7 lb)
  • Multiple-wavelength single-mode OTDR
  • 1.5 m (typ.) event dead zone
  • 26 dB dynamic range
  • Integrated OPM, OLS, and VFL (650 nm)
  • Tool-free, switchable adapters for OTDR & OPM ports (FC, SC, ST, LC, E2000 are available)
  • Bellcore (GR-196) .SOR file format
  • Rechargeable (> 12 hr) LiIon battery or AC power
  • 3.5-inch, indoor/outdoor LCD
  • Windows® compatible software to view, print, and archive test record
  • Mini USB Port (connect to PC with cable)
